POSITION SUMMARY:

Responsible for assisting FS&QA leadership in the development and implementation of the facility HACCP and SQF programs. This position is responsible for the daily monitoring and assessment of program effectiveness and makes necessary changes to programs.

RESPONSIBILITIES:

  • Monitor through inspection the assigned production line(s) for product and packaging specifications, SQF and HACCP pre-requisite programs, regulatory compliance, sanitation effectiveness, and good manufacturing practices.
  • Assist in verification and validation that the HACCP and SQF programs are working as designed.
  • Perform and verify checks for HACCP and SQF paperwork on the production floor.
  • Review paperwork as assigned by the manager.
  • Assist in maintaining systems to assure facility meets all SQF system requirements including Commitment, Document Control and Records, Specifications, Attaining Food Safety, Verification, Product Identification Trace and Recall, Incident Management, Food Safety Fundamentals - Building and Equipment Design and Construction, and Food Safety Fundamentals - Pre-requisite Programs.
  • Assist in maintaining all registries as required by SQF.
  • Oversee monitoring, verification, and validation activities to ensure that all products leaving the facility meet the facility Food Safety and Quality Plans. Make any necessary corrections to ensure a safe, quality product.
  • Monitor and develop recommendations for HACCP/SQF program when there is a change to a program, process, procedure, ingredient, equipment, industry philosophy, technology, etc.
  • Conduct on-going sanitation inspection of production lines and related facilities during production operation hours.
  • Provide written and/or computerized reports of the monitoring results to designated management personnel.
  • Track, verify and report hold product.
  • Must be able to lift, push, pull or carry up to 50lbs.
  • Carry out any special tasks per the request of the QA Manager.
  • Cross-train with team members in various other departments as deemed necessary by the QA Manager.
  • In the event that the HACCP Technician is absent or missing for any reason, a trained designee will be appointed by HACCP SQF Specialist to cover any job tasks.
